If your PC hangs on shutdowns and restarts, you likely have a background application that is causing this to happen, or hardware that's connected and causing issues.
Start by removing USB devices that are externally-connected -- especially hard drives and thumb drives -- and see if matters change.
If they do, then you have a problem hardware device. Reconnect one-by-one to work out which is problematic.
If disconnecting hardware doesn't change matters, move on by disabling all applications that auto-start with with Windows.
Right click Start, click Task Manager, then navigate to Startup Apps.
Right click each app and set its status to Disabled.

Now shut down, and see if the behavior is the same. If it is, it may be because the changes you just made aren't yet in place.
Hard power-off the PC by holding the power button down for ten seconds, then power-on again.
Once Windows boots, shut down and see if Windows hangs.
If it does, then you still have an application or application-related service that's running in the background and causing issues.
Click Start, type: System Configuration.
The System Configuration window will open:
Tick the radio box next to Normal Startup. Hit Apply. You'll be prompted to reboot, allow the PC to do so.
If the PC hangs on the reboot and will not do so, hard shut-off as instructed above, then power-on again, and see if matters change.
If they still don't, then there is still software in the background causing issues, and you may need to use an application such as Autoruns to dig deeper into what is automatically running in the background of your PC. You may download it from Microsoft here: https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/sysinternals/downloads/autoruns
Run it and follow instructions on the above link to disable auto-starting applications and services that could cause issues.
